Average Merchandise Displayers and Window Trimmers Salary in North Port-Bradenton-Sarasota, FL

Merchandise Displayers and Window Trimmers in the North Port-Bradenton-Sarasota, FL area earn an average annual salary of $38,950. This figure is slightly below the national average of $40,540, indicating a localized compensation trend. Factors such as regional demand, the cost of doing business, and the overall economic climate within this specific Florida metropolitan area contribute to this pay differential.
